Excelsior Correspondent
JAMMU, July 15: To commemorate Plastic Surgery Day, Dr Ravi Mahajan (Chief Plastic Surgeon at Amandeep Hospital, Amritsar) and the dedicated team of six accomplished surgeons of the Hospital will generously offer their expertise to benefit those who are less fortunate.
Six deserving patients, unable to afford the cost of surgery, will be selected to receive life-altering procedures free of charge. By extending their skills and compassion to those in need, these dedicated professionals aim to positively impact the lives of individuals who would otherwise be unable to access such transformative care. Driven by a passion for enhancing lives through surgical intervention, Dr Ravi Mahajan has dedicated his career to the advancement of plastic surgery in India.
